Marcos Jr. vows to prioritize modernization of PH Marine Corps

Harlene Delgado,

ABS-CBN News

Clipboard

MANILA — President Ferdinand Marcos Jr. has vowed to prioritize the modernization of Philippine Marine Corps (PMC) and boost its defense capabilities. 

He said this in a speech at the PMC’s 74th anniversary celebration at the Philippine International Convention Center (PICC) in Pasay City on Thursday, November 7, 2024. 

The president honored the decades-long commitment of the Marines in promoting peace and security, protecting lives and asserting the country’s sovereignty. 

He also acknowledged the growing challenges in defending Philippine islands and protecting its shores, as he vowed to provide support in advancing the Marines' mandate.

"We are committed to building a stronger and more comprehensive defense posture by investing  in modern infrastructure, upgrading facilities, facilities that will boost your operations,” Marcos Jr. noted.

“We will continue to prioritize modernization ensuring that your defense capabilities align with our nation's strategic needs,” he said.

 Marcos Jr. also recalled the time that he trained as a Marine. 

“Joining this force transformed me in ways nothing outside of the military or of the marine corps could possibly have given me,” Marcos Jr. said.

Meanwhile, PMC Commandant Maj. Gen. Arturo Rojas also vowed to continue the Marines' commitment in serving the public especially in times of crisis.

“The Filipino people will continue to expect and the nation will count on their marines to be the leading edge in humanitarian relief and disaster, recovery operations."

Marcos Jr. also conferred awards to exemplary members and led a cake-cutting ceremony.

Established on November 2, 1950, the PMC serves as the naval infantry force of the Philippine Navy.
